Young Shenzhen designer. There isn't a lot of discussion about him online but there is this great Medium article about him.

I think he does MTM stuff in Australia and he also sells RTW online through Taobao. His Taobao store is here.

I recently bought a dark gray denim shirt from him (link here) and I was really happy with it. Nicely shanked gorgeous mother of pearl buttons, French placket, cutaway collar with a **** for collar stays, nice fabric - just little details that would bring joy to anyone who also likes SF, Spier & MacKay, Armoury/Drakes, andreasweinas's instagram, and #menswearzzzz in general. Extremely nice fit on me OTR that won't require tailoring but that's a personal/subjective thing. It was also around US$50 shipped so I think it's extremely good value.

O1CN01m10oeK1cm55QnwW4R_!!3375673642.jpg


I really like his colors too, it's all calming/muted grays/browns/blues.

One of three polos I got. I like this one the best, still on the fence with the other two. Tbh I'm having a bit of buyer's remorse with the color due to my skin tone.

It's comfy though. Silk and cashmere so very soft.

The shipping and fees cost way more than I expected though (~120 USD) and I'm not sure if it would be worth it to continue buying stuff without being able to see it in person knowing I'd be stuck with it afterward. If I ever made a trip out to China and could buy from a store I think it's worth it.
